Winston-Salem, NC | Paid Internship | Summer 2026 Application Window: March 25 – April 30, 2026 Session Dates: June 1 – August 7, 2026 (10–12 weeks) About the Role An NBC affiliate in Winston‑Salem, North Carolina is offering a paid summer internship in its newsroom. This is a hands‑on opportunity to shadow working journalists and production staff while gaining real experience in a live, deadline‑driven news environment. Interns will be placed in one of five tracks based on interest and availability: News Producer, News Reporter, Video Journalist, Digital Producer, or Technical Production. This is a strong fit for students or early‑career candidates looking to build practical skills in local television news, from writing and reporting to control room operations and digital content. Internship Tracks News Producer Collaborating with news managers and producers to identify the day's top stories Learning to write broadcast copy, research stories for accuracy, and work under tight deadlines Assisting with the execution of live newscasts from the control room alongside production staff Creating graphic elements including lower‑third supers and full‑screen graphics Communicating with reporters to understand story details and develop compelling teases Working alongside reporters and photographers to cover local news Writing stories for both broadcast and online platforms Shooting standups and practicing live shots Learning the full technical workflow of a local news reporter Video Journalist Gathering video and interview content, then assembling stories for broadcast Making quick assessments around safety and situational concerns in the field Collaboration with reporters to tell visually compelling stories Learning proper care and maintenance of news equipment Digital Producer Working with the digital team to identify and prioritize daily stories Learning to produce content in a CMS that supports web and social platforms Writing copy, researching stories for accuracy, and coordinating with reporters Building the technical skills needed to work as a digital producer Technical Production Training on all aspects of behind‑the‑scenes newscast production: directing, technical directing, audio, and camera operation Learning how control room roles work together to execute a live newscast Operating newscast execution software, graphics systems, and live field elements Communicating under pressure to troubleshoot issues during live broadcasts To Apply Visit Mediabistro for full details and application instructions.
